EDITORS COMMENTS
This photograph captures Lady Randolph Churchill, née Jennie Jerome (1854-1921), in an elegant riding habit as she confidently rides a horse. Lady Randolph, the mother of Sir Winston Churchill and wife of the Tory politician Randolph Churchill, was known for her beauty, wit, and charisma, making her a prominent figure in Victorian high society. Born in New York City to a wealthy American family, Jennie Jerome was a celebrated socialite who married Randolph Churchill in 1874. Their marriage was marked by scandal and controversy, including rumors of infidelity and political intrigue. Despite these challenges, Lady Randolph remained a devoted mother to her five children, including the future prime minister, Winston. In this photograph, Lady Randolph exudes an air of sophistication and grace as she rides through the English countryside. The high-necked habit, adorned with a belt and jodhpurs, was a popular choice for Victorian women who enjoyed riding. The image not only showcases Lady Randolph's equestrian skills but also her striking appearance and confident demeanor. As a political figure in her own right, Lady Randolph played a significant role in her husband's political career. She served as a Conservative Party agent and a Whip, using her charisma and connections to help secure votes for the Tory cause. Her influence extended beyond her husband's political career, as she was also known for her philanthropy and support of various charitable causes. This photograph offers a glimpse into the life of Lady Randolph Churchill, a remarkable woman who defied societal expectations and left an indelible mark on history as the mother of one of the greatest statesmen of the 20th century.
